Thugs Steal State House Drug Monitoring Unit Computers.

Suspected thugs on Monday night broke into the State House Medicine and Health Service Delivery Monitoring Unit head offices and stole computers suspected to contain vital information on corruption investigations.

The Public Relations Officer of the unit, Detective Assistant Superintendent of Police Frank Byaruhanga, said: "We suspect that the thugs' interest was not in the computers but in the information that was stored in them. Investigations have already started and we are sure that the suspects will be arrested soon." So far no one has been arrested.
